Our take

Baliflora opens with a quick citrus flash of tangerine, sharp and almost metallic, before the white floral brigade storms in: frangipani, lotus, lily, orange blossom, jasmine. It is a crowded garden, each flower elbowing for attention, and Jean-Claude Ellena’s signature minimalist touch feels oddly absent here. The heart is dense, sweet, and slightly aquatic, like a greenhouse after a rain shower with the windows sealed shut. The drydown settles into a musky, powdery blanket that flattens the earlier exuberance into something limp and polite.

The overall impression is a tropical bouquet left in a warm car for an hour. It is moderately sweet, leaning synthetic in the opening but softening into a more natural musk over time. This is firmly niche in intent but mainstream in execution, a white floral crowd-pleaser that lacks the weirdness or lift Ellena is known for. With longevity scraping just above 3 and sillage barely whispering above 2, Baliflora evaporates faster than you’d hope for the price. It suits someone who wants an easy, sunny spring or summer floral for daytime errands or a casual brunch, but anyone craving depth, projection, or staying power should look elsewhere. The flowers are pretty, but they wilt too quickly to leave a mark. 🌸
